从深入浅出使用Redis集群查看主从配置(redis集群查看主)

2023-05-16 15:58:57 集群 查看 主从

Redis集群作为一种常用的分布式缓存存储,在大多数Web应用中都很常见,它能够提供优异的性能以保障应用的正常运行,能够显著缩短应用响应时间。Redis集群由多个Redis实例组成,其中一个为主实例,其余均为从实例,从实例会复制主实例中的所有数据,从而能够提供高可用性。对于Redis集群查看主从配置,也就是检查主从实例之间的数据复制是否正常,及时发现主从数据不一致的问题,应用程序可以更好的正常运行。那么,我们又是如何查看Redis集群的主从配置的呢?

从深入浅出来看,首先我们可以使用Redis客户端,连接到Redis集群后执行以下命令来检查当前的实例信息:

  127.0.0.1:7002> INFO replication
# Replication
role:master
connected_slaves:3
slave0:ip=127.0.0.1,port=7003,state=online,offset=755136,lag=1
slave1:ip=127.0.0.1,port=7004,state=online,offset=755136,lag=0
slave2:ip=127.0.0.1,port=7005,state=online,offset=755136,lag=1

上述命令执行结果显示,当前实例是一台主实例,且有三个从实例,同时也能够看到每个从实例的IP地址、端口及连接状态。

使用Node.js作为Redis客户端也能够检查Redis集群的主从配置,可以通过Node.js中的Redis库来建立Redis连接,并通过info命令来查看当前实例的信息:

“`javascript

let Redis = require(‘redis’); let redisClient = Redis.createClient({port:7002,host:’127.0.0.1′});

redisClient.info(“replication”,function(err,res){

console.log(res);

})


可以看到Node.js返回的与命令行相同的结果,因此可以使用Node.js来检查Redis集群信息,并有效构建出健壮、可扩展的分布式应用。

要检查Redis集群的主从配置,可以使用Redis客户端连接Redis集群,进行info操作以查看当前的实例信息,也可以使用Node.js编程语言构建Redis客户端来进行查询,这些查询方法能够有效地检查Redis集群的主从配置,从而确保主从实例之间的数据保持一致,确保应用程序正常运行。

相关文章